一种iptv专网和互联网的双网访问方法_2

文档序号:9891218阅读:来源:国知局
发明的限定。
实施例
[0013]如图1所示,本发明一种IPTV专网和互联网的双网访问方法,按照以下步骤进行: (a)终端设备启动时,专网终端读取预先设置的数据获得IPTV专网的服务端首个访问地址;
(b )专网终端向服务端的首个访问地址发起访问请求;
(C)专网终端将终端设备和服务端之间的交互数据复制给路由管理器处理;
(d)路由管理器将接收到的交互数据进行解析并提取出内含的IPTV专网的IP地址或域名,将得到的IP地址或域名动态添加到专网路由表;
(dl)路由管理器接收交互数据并判断该数据是否是HTML格式,如果判断结果为真,则解析该HTML格式的数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行步骤(d2);
例如下面是一个HTML数据中包含IP地址的示例:
document.locat1n.href=〃http://10.125.1.105/html/ExtendsJavascript/index.html;
将通过检索得到IP地址“10.125.1.105”加入路由表中形成动态路由表;如果判断结果为假,则进行步骤(d2);
(d2)路由管理器判断接收到的数据是否是RTSP、IGMP或者HTTP流媒体协议,如果判断结果为真,则解析该RTSP、IGMP或者HTTP协议数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行步骤(d3);
例如下面是一个RTPS数据中包含IP地址的示例:
PLAY rtsp://mediasvr.com/m/baz.mpg RTSP/1.0CSeq: 5
Sess1n: 719885386Scale: 4.0Range: npt=15_30
通过检索得到域名“mediasvr.com”,转换成IP地址,加入路由表中形成动态路由表;如果判断结果为假,则进行步骤(d3);
(d3)路由管理器判断接收到的数据是否是TR069协议,如果判断结果为真,则解析该TR069协议数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行下一个交互数据的判断。
[0014]例如下面是一个TR069数据中包含IP地址的示例:
<ParameterValueStruct>
<Name>Device.X_ IPTV.StatisticConfigurat1n.LogServerUrI</Name>〈Value xs1:type=〃xsd:String〃>ftp://1:1il0.125.1.115</Value></ParameterValueStruct>
通过检索得到IP地址“10.125.1.115”加入路由表中形成动态路由表;如果判断结果为假,则删除该数据,并进行下一个交互数据的判断;
(e)上层软件接收用户的操作指令,并向服务端发送访问请求。路由管理器根据专网路由表,把交互数据分配到IPTV专网或者互联网的访问路径上,并连接该路径。
[0015]以上所述的【具体实施方式】,对本发明的目的、技术方案和有益效果进行了进一步详细说明,所应理解的是,以上所述仅为本发明的【具体实施方式】而已,并不用于限定本发明的保护范围,凡在本发明的精神和原则之内,所做的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。
【主权项】
1.一种IPTV专网和互联网的双网访问方法,其特征在于,包括以下步骤: (a)终端设备启动时,专网终端读取预先设置的数据获得IPTV专网的服务端首个访问地址; (b )专网终端向服务端的首个访问地址发起访问请求; (C)专网终端将终端设备和服务端之间的交互数据复制给路由管理器处理; (d)路由管理器将接收到的交互数据进行解析并提取出内含的IPTV专网的IP地址或域名,将得到的IP地址或域名动态添加到专网路由表; (e)在上层软件接收用户的操作指令,向服务端发送访问请求时,路由管理器根据专网路由表,把交互数据分配到IPTV专网或者互联网的访问路径上,并连接该路径。2.根据权利要求1所述的一种IPTV专网和互联网的双网访问方法,其特征在于:所述步骤(d)包括以下步骤: (dl)路由管理器接收交互数据并判断该数据是否是HTML格式,如果判断结果为真,则解析该HTML格式的数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行步骤(d2); (d2)路由管理器判断接收到的数据是否是RTSP、IGMP或者HTTP流媒体协议,如果判断结果为真,则解析该RTSP、IGMP或者HTTP协议数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行步骤(d3); (d3)路由管理器判断接收到的数据是否是TR069协议,如果判断结果为真,则解析该TR069协议数据,分析其中的IP地址和域名,并将该IP地址和域名添加到专网路由表中形成动态路由表;如果判断结果为假,则进行下一个交互数据的判断。
【专利摘要】本发明公布了一种IPTV专网和互联网的双网访问方法,包括(a)终端设备启动时,专网终端读取预先设置的数据获得IPTV专网的服务端首个访问地址;(b)专网终端向服务端的首个访问地址发起访问请求;(c)专网终端将终端设备和服务端之间的交互数据复制给路由管理器处理;(d)路由管理器将得到的IP地址或域名动态添加到专网路由表;(e)在上层软件接收用户的操作指令,并连接该路径。本发明是采用终端解析通信的数据包协议,解析出专网的IP或者域名,并动态生成专网路由表,用于区分数据包是访问专网还是互联网,无需管理员人工维护,大大提升了建设、维护效率。
【IPC分类】H04L12/741, H04N21/643, H04L29/12, H04L29/08, H04L12/24
【公开号】CN105656674
【申请号】
【发明人】钟海山
【申请人】成都卓影科技股份有限公司
【公开日】2016年6月8日
【申请日】2016年1月19日
...
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1